General Information

Help on Chemical  Formula: Chemical Formula: K2Na(Ca,Mn++)2(Ti,Fe)O[Si7O18(OH)]
Help on Composition: Composition: Molecular Weight = 728.74 gm)
 
  Potassium 10.73 % K
 
  Calcium 9.62 % Ca
 
  Titanium 5.58 % Ti
 
  Manganese 1.88 % Mn
 
  Iron 1.15 % Fe
 
  Silicon 26.98 % Si
 
  Hydrogen 0.14 % H
 
  Oxygen 43.91 % O
Help on Empirical Formula: Empirical Formula: K2Ca1.75Mn2+0.25Ti0.85Fe2+0.15Si7O19(OH)
Help on Environment: Environment: K-feldspar metasomatites in contact with limestone.
Help on IMA Status: IMA Status: Approved IMA 1965
Help on Locality: Locality: Murun alkalic massif, near Olekminsk, Yakutia, Russia.
Help on Name Origin: Name Origin: Named fro the symbols of some of its component elements (Ti, Na, K).
 

Classification

Help on  Dana Class: Dana Class: 67.2.1.1 (67)Inosilicate Unbranched Chains with W>2
  (67.2)with W=5
  (67.2.1)Dana Group
Help on  Strunz Class: Strunz Class: VIII/F.22-30 VIII - Silicates
  VIII/F - Inosilicates (chain and band) Triplet chains [Si6O15/17]6-/10- and modified triplet bands
  VIII/F.22 - Zorite - Tinaksite series
 

Crystallography

Help on Axial Ratios: Axial Ratios: a:b:c =0.8504:1:0.5792
Help on Cell Dimensions: Cell Dimensions: a = 10.35, b = 12.17, c = 7.05, Z = 2; alpha = 91ø, beta = 99.333ø, gamma = 92.5ø V = 875.29 Den(Calc)= 2.76
Help on Crystal System: Crystal System: Triclinic Space Group: P1,P1-
Help on X Ray Diffraction: X Ray Diffraction: By Intensity(I/Io): 3.3(1) 3.25(0.8) 2.331(0.56)
 

Physical Properties

Help on Cleavage: Cleavage: [010] Perfect, [110] Indistinct
Help on Color: Color: pink, pale yellow, or light brown.
Help on Density: Density: 2.82
Help on Diaphaniety: Diaphaniety: Transparent to Translucent
Help on Habits: Habits: Prismatic - Crystals Shaped like Slender Prisms (e.g. tourmaline)., Radial - Crystals radiate from a center without producing stellar forms (e.g. stibnite), Fibrous - Crystals made up of fibers.
Help on Hardness: Hardness: 6 - Orthoclase
Help on Luster: Luster: Vitreous (Glassy)
Help on Streak: Streak: white
 

Optical Properties

Help on Optical Data: Optical Data: Biaxial (+), a=1.593, b=1.621, g=1.666, bire=0.0730
Help on Pleochroism (x): Pleochroism (x): colorless.
Help on Pleochroism (y): Pleochroism (y): colorless.
Help on Pleochroism (z): Pleochroism (z): pale orange yellow.
